We are situated just one mile from the scenic A686 which links Penrith and The Lakes to Northumberland. We are located approximately nine miles northeast of Penrith, just before you climb up the scenic winding fell road - the Hartside Pass - with its hairpin bends (not for the faint-hearted) towards Alston, England's Highest Market Town. From the top of the pass, you can appreciate breath-taking views of Cumbria, the Solway Firth and into Scotland (1,903 feet above sea level).
